Fed Surprises With 50bps Cut; I AM OUT

Funny how I was just praising them and now I hate them again.

ALRIGHT ALRIGHT ALRIGHT.

They didn’t have to step in with a 50bps cut. They probably succumbed to Trump pressure, once again, and fucked themselves and the market. This looks like weakness.

“The coronavirus poses evolving risks to economic activity,” the Fed said in a statement. “In light of these risks and in support of achieving its maximum employment and price stability goals, the Federal Open Market Committee decided today to lower the target range for the federal funds rate.”

I know, it’s just the flu bro. More people died in that tornado last night than the virus. I know. But you know what? Fuck yourself. The coronavirus is a legit risk and just because people aren’t dying in the billions doesn’t mean we should ignore it. The death rate in Iran for it is 3.3%. I know, illuminati. Fuck yourself. The point I am making is it matters because humans have declared it to matter. Ok? The affects of this virus has shaken confidence to its core and that is translating into SHARPLY LOWER growth projections. As such, and this goes without saying, I am out.

We might rally, but I don’t think we will. I sold out of all the positions I had put on yesterday, in many cases small profits and losses. I have two positions left and a 90% cash horde. My goal is to execute the perfect trade. With that in mind, back to work.
